Objectives
The primary objective of this study is to evaluate the difference in **live birth rate (LBR)** among women with **Recurrent Pregnancy Loss** (RPL) who are treated with **Hydroxychloroquine (HCQ)** compared to those receiving a placebo. This is assessed using an Intention to Treat (ITT) analysis, which includes all participants regardless of adherence to the treatment protocol. The clinical relevance of this objective lies in its potential to provide evidence for a therapeutic option that could improve LBR in women experiencing RPL, a condition associated with significant emotional and physical burden.
Secondary objectives include:
- Assessing the difference in LBR for women treated with HCQ versus placebo, excluding cases of pregnancy loss due to chromosome abnormalities, ectopic pregnancy, neglect of treatment, induced abortion, or early withdrawal from treatment (Per Protocol (PP) analysis).
- Evaluating birth weight, duration of pregnancy, Apgar score five minutes after birth, and the number of days admitted to a neonatal department. This aims to determine if HCQ treatment can reduce preterm birth, perinatal morbidities, and low birth weight, or if it increases perinatal complications compared to placebo.
- Investigating immune and inflammatory profiles in women treated with HCQ versus placebo, and comparing women with live births to those with another pregnancy loss. This includes analyzing pre-pregnancy inflammatory levels to identify high responders and understanding pregnancy complications to identify high-risk groups early.
- Monitoring metabolic activity using ultra-low dose FDG-PET/CT scans in a sub-study, focusing on the uterus and immune-related tissues such as bone marrow, spleen, thymus, and lymph nodes, to correlate metabolic activity with inflammation grade.

Plans and Procedures
The clinical trial is designed to evaluate the efficacy of **hydroxychloroquine sulfate** in treating **Recurrent Pregnancy Loss**. This is a randomized, double-blind, placebo-controlled trial, which aims to monitor the difference in live birth rate among women treated with hydroxychloroquine compared to those receiving a placebo. The trial will include 186 women who meet the inclusion criteria of having experienced at least three or four confirmed consecutive pregnancy losses prior to gestational age 22+0, with specific conditions regarding second-trimester losses. The trial is set to conclude after the inclusion and follow-up of these participants, which will extend to either a pregnancy loss or six months post-live birth.
The trial is expected to run from April 1, 2017, to December 31, 2027. Participants will be involved in the study for a maximum treatment period of 80 days, with a daily dose of 200 mg of hydroxychloroquine administered orally. The study visits will include an initial screening visit to confirm eligibility, followed by regular follow-up visits to monitor the participants' health and pregnancy status. The end-of-study visit will occur after the completion of the follow-up period. Participants who become pregnant less than two months after starting the medication or do not achieve pregnancy within one year will be replaced 1:1 by new patients.
Conditions that may lead to early termination from the study include non-compliance with the study protocol, adverse reactions to the medication, or withdrawal of consent by the participant. Treatment
The clinical trial involves the administration of **Plaquenil**, a film-coated tablet containing **hydroxychloroquine sulfate** as the active substance. The pharmaceutical form is a film-coated tablet, and the medication is administered orally. The dosage is set at 200 mg per day, with a maximum total dose of 112,000 mg over the course of the treatment period, which spans up to 80 days. The tablets are encapsulated in gelatin capsules and provided in containers of 100 units. The active substance, hydroxychloroquine sulfate, is of chemical origin and is classified under the ATC code P01BA02. The product is manufactured by SANOFI A/S and is authorized for use in Denmark.

Inclusion and Exclusion Criteria
Inclusion Criteria
- ≥ 4 confirmed consecutive pregnancy losses prior to gestational age 22+0 in women with unexplained recurrent pregnancy loss (RPL)
- ≥ 3 confirmed consecutive pregnancy losses prior to gestational age 22+0 in women with unexplained RPL with minimum one second trimester loss
Exclusion Criteria
- Age < 18 years or > 40 years
- Prominent uterine abnormalities detected by hysterosalpingography/hysteroscopy or hydrosonography
- Known prominent chromosome abnormalities for the couple trying to conceive
- A menstrual cycle < 23 days or > 35 days if the pregnancy is conceived naturally. If the woman received fertility treatment the menstrual cycle has no consequence.
- Detection of positive lupus-anticoagulant or positive IgG/IgM for anticardiolipin-antibodies (≥10 GPL kU/l, measured at the same laboratories at the Capital Region of Denmark) or plasma homocysteine ≥25 microgram/l by repeated measurements 12 weeks apart before the pregnancy.
- Positive HIV test or test indicating chronic hepatitis B or C.
- Psoriasis, retinopathic or serious hearing deficiency (contraindication for treatment with HCQ)
- Current chronic disease implicating a constant consumption of immunomodulatory medicine or medicine potentially harmful to the pregnancy/embryo
- Hgb ≤ 6.5 mmol/L, leucocytes < 3.5 E9/L, thrombocytes < 145 E9/L by the time of inclusion
- Previous HCQ treatment in relation to conceive
- > 1 previous live birth.
- Previous participation in current study.
